WebOct 13, 2024 · The corner is approximately 88 degrees. So the miter cut needs to be at 46 degrees. Since the baseboard is taller than the miter fence, I cannot make the cut with the baseboard vertical. So the cut needs to be made with baseboard on the flat (on the bed of the miter saw). WebSep 5, 2024 · Mark outside corners with a sharp utility knife. It’s far more precise than a pencil mark. Repeat the marking process on the opposite baseboard. Cut 45-1/2-degree angles on both boards, leaving each an extra 1/8 in. long. 2. Cut the Fit. If the miter is open on the front, increase the cutting angle to about 46 degrees and recut both sides.
